The GJB will be back at Aunt Chilada's on Sunday, September 21, 2025 from 6 to 8 PM with special guest cornetist Lew Green (since 1957 leader of the Original Salty Dogs) along with Russ Whitman on clarinet & sax, Jim Fryer on trombone, Charlie Freeman on piano, Art Hovey on tuba & bass, Tom Palinko on drums, and vocalist Cynthia Fabian. The GJB has performed monthly at Aunt Chilada's (usually on the third Sunday of the month) since July of 2009 with the exception of the Covid year and the bad-weather closings in January and February of 2025. Known since 1993 as the best Mexican restaurant in the greater New Haven area, Aunt Chilada's is located at 3931 Whitney Avenue, just a couple of miles north of Sleeping Giant in Hamden, beside the golf course. Seating is somewhat limited; please call 203-230-4640 to reserve a table or a seat at the bar. There is no cover charge, and no minimum. An Early History of the Galvanized Jazz Band appeared in the July 2021 issue of the Syncopated Times. The second installment, The Millpond Years is in the August issue. The third part, After The Millpond Years, is in the October 2021 issue. Non-subscribers can see each of them by clicking on the blue lettering.
Over in Holland
Gerard Bielderman has published a very complete
Galvanized Jazz Band Discography describing our recordings on LP, cassette, and CD, including
some that even we didn't know about. Gerard has already published discographies of many other well-known bands
and performers; we are honored to be included among them. (Ours is listed in the "Swinging American" section of
his website.)
